Companies
About Us
Applicant Tracking System (ATS)
New
English
English
Deutsch
Post Job
sewts
https://www.sewts.com/home
Claim This Company
Home
Browse Companies
sewts
Open Position at sewts in Germany
AI Developer
Company Location
sewts
Garching bei München,
BY,
Germany
Share it!
Interesting?
Share it!